Vancouver, British Columbia--(Newsfile Corp. - September 9, 2026) - Avanti Gold Corp. (CSE: AGC) (FSE: X370) (OTCQB: AVTGF) ("Avanti" or the "Company") is pleased to provide an update on regional exploration activities at the Akyanga East and the Ngalula Prospects, located within the Company's Misisi Gold Project in the southeastern Democratic Republic of the Congo.

Recent work at Akyanga East has included re-logging of historical drill core, litho-structural mapping and rock-chip sampling, with encouraging results being used to refine planned follow-up drilling along the approximately 2.5 km mineralized corridor.

At Ngalula, geological mapping, rock-chip sampling and channel sampling have identified multiple surface gold occurrences and two parallel mineralized trends. Initial rock-chip assays returned values of up to 19.98 g/t Au, while channel sampling returned several open-ended mineralized intervals extending the known bedrock mineralization by an additional 1.5 km to the southeast. The initial results include:

  • NGCH01: 3.0 m @ 1.88 g/t Au, open-ended

  • NGCH02: 1.7 m @ 0.73 g/t Au, open-ended

  • NGCH04: 3.3 m @ 1.75 g/t Au, open-ended

  • NGCH06: 2.8 m @ 0.80 g/t Au, open-ended

The results will be integrated with existing soil geochemistry and mapping to refine the geological interpretation and support future drill targeting.

ABOUT THE NGALULA PROSPECT

The Ngalula Prospect is located at the southern end of Misisi Permit, approximately 28 km south-east of the main Akyanga deposit. The prospect is defined by parallel zones of high-grade gold-in-soil anomalies extending over 8 km of strike. Historical trenching across approximately 1 km of the geochemical trend returned notable gold intersections, including 6.0 m at 5.18 g/t Au and 6.0 m at 2.13 g/t Au (Figure 1).

Geological mapping is progressing concurrently with rock-chip and channel sampling. The lithological units generally dip approximately 75° toward the southwest (SW). The structural characteristics will provide improved understanding of the geological controls on mineralization and will assist in refining follow-up drilling. Initial results (Table 1) received from the rock-chip sampling, has confirmed the presence of high-grade gold mineralization. Two parallel mineralized zones have been defined based on soil geochemistry, artisanal workings, and recent geological mapping (Figure 1).

Channel samples cut across the strike of the mineralization returned encouraging and continuous gold trends, extending the bedrock mineralization by an additional 1.5 km to the southeast. Table 2 summarises the results of the channel sampling.

At Ngalula, geological mapping, rock-chip sampling and channel sampling will continue to test the strike continuity of the two parallel mineralized zones defined by soil geochemistry and recent geological mapping to support optimal planning of the upcoming drilling program (Figure 1).

ABOUT THE AKYANGA EAST PROSPECT

The Akyanga East Prospect is a parallel structure located 500 meters east of the main Akyanga deposit. Thirteen (13) diamond drillholes totaling 1,630.6 meters were previously drilled over the 2.5km mineralised quartz vein system at Akyanga East Prospect (Figure 2).

Re-logging of the previous holes followed by a rapid litho-structural mapping exercise has provided additional geological understanding and recent rock-chip sampling has returned encouraging gold values from Akyanga East, including 5.36 g/t Au, 2.83 g/t Au, 1.10 g/t Au and 1.00 g/t Au. These results have helped to refine plans for a 2,500 meter Phase 1 follow-up drilling program to test the previously identified mineralization. A total of 15 drillholes have been planned, covering approximately 2.5 km of strike length across the mineralized zones (Figure 2). Site preparation activities are underway.

QUALITY CONTROL AND QUALITY ASSURANCE

The rock-chip and channel samples were placed in sealed sample bags under the supervision of Company geologists and transported to the independent SGS laboratory in Mwanza, Tanzania. Samples were crushed to 80% passing 2 mm, after which a split of up to 1.5 kg was pulverized to 90% passing 75 microns. Gold analysis was completed by fire assay using a 50-gram aliquot. Screen fire assays were used as check assays for selected high-grade samples. As part of the Company's QA/QC program, certified reference materials, blanks and duplicates were inserted into the sample stream prior to submission to SGS.

ABOUT MISISI

The Misisi Project site is located in the Fizi territory of South Kivu Province, in the DRC, approximately 250 kilometers south of Bukavu and 180 kilometers north of Kalemie. The Akyanga Deposit, located centrally in the Misisi Project, hosts an NI 43-101 compliant Inferred Mineral Resource of 40.8 million tonnes averaging 2.37 g/t gold containing 3.11 million ounces which was based on 19,956 metres of historic drilling, including 105 diamond drillholes ("DD") totalling 19,070 meters and six reverse circulation ("RC") drillholes totalling 887 meters. The Akyanga resource is determined from surface to a vertical depth of 350 meters over a strike length of 2,100 metres, using a US$1,500/oz pit shell. The mineralization remains open at depth and along strike. Beyond the Akyanga deposit, the Misisi Project hosts five high-priority satellite targets-Akyanga East, Nglula, Tulonge, Lubitchako and Kilombwe-all within 25 km of Akyanga, providing multiple compelling opportunities for new discoveries and significant resource expansion.

GEOLOGY AND MINERALIZATION

The geology of the Misisi project area is dominated by Proterozoic meta-sediments comprising interbedded quartz muscovite schists, schistose arkoses, muscovite quartzites, and quartzites; pebble conglomerates and foliated mafic intrusion. Gold mineralization is associated with numerous zones of stacked quartz veins that occur sub-parallel to bedding. The mineralized zones have strike lengths of up to 2,000 m and are generally less than 10 m thick. At the southern end of the Akyanga deposit the vein zones dip moderate to shallowly to the southeast. In the central and northern part, the deposit steepens at surface, such that at the northern end the mineralization is near vertical at surface and flattening out down dip. The depth of weathering is estimated to be approximately 30 m. Mineralization is structurally and lithologically controlled, in association with local deformation zones, and occurs along north-south striking structures. The current interpretation is that the base of a mafic unit provides a contact with hardness contrast along which there has been structural movement.

ABOUT AVANTI GOLD CORP

Avanti Gold Corp. is a gold exploration company focused on advancing its flagship Misisi Project in the Democratic Republic of Congo (DRC), home to the high-grade Akyanga gold deposit. The Akyanga deposit has an Inferred Mineral Resource of 40.8 million tonnes (Mt) at an average gold grade of 2.37 grams per tonne (g/t), totaling 3.11 million ounces (Moz) of gold. The Misisi Project spans three contiguous 30-year mining leases covering 133 square kilometers (km²) along the 55-kilometer-long Kibara Gold Belt, a prominent metallogenic province known for hosting significant gold deposits. A 42,000-metre drill program, the largest in the project's history, is now underway with the objective of growing gold resources in advance of a Preliminary Economic Assessment anticipated in 2027.
